The work is part of my last series "Unfolding the rainbow" - because emotions, from an artistic point of view, have their own rainbow. The composition of all works, from the dimensional point of view, is related to the Fibonacci Sequence which led me to the realization of some Surreal constructions. In realization of paintings, I used just the three primary colors: red, yellow, and blue, complemented in a proportion less than 10% by the achromatic white and black. In creating this series, I started from the idea that the color is almost always a social reality more than a visual one. Ontologically impure, because they always oscillate between themselves and the viewer, the colors are available for any kind of appropriation and they represent an unspoken language. They are chromatic words that shapes our lives. The color, for both the artist and the viewer, is often a thought that conveys an emotion and this is the message of my works.

I was born in Slanic, a very small town in Romania. Having grown up surrounded by nature and old, traditional and mystical stories, my orientation towards art has come naturally. With a background in engineering, my decision to change fields and pursue fine arts came easy. The step I took towards art has been made by enrolling in the hobby painting classes organized by the Romanian visual artist and writer, Alina Gherasim. A few years later I graduated Fine Arts at University of Hertfordshire, in the United Kingdom. I am interested in exploring my own cultural identity and Romanian traditions and folklore. I engage with social events and how they have an impact over us. Living in an era of huge technological evolution, my works can be seen as a contemporary representation of what I consider important to be remember and what is important to be conserved. I approach a figurative style in painting, which I consider part of my national identity. Sometimes, I combine this approach with new technologies using digital collages or films in order to preserve the authentic models. My classic style is inspired by the Impressionist masters who made me love painting. The fragmentation of objects, I believe that came from Cubism, from great painters such as Gris, Braque and Picasso. But many other contemporary artists influenced my work: Julie Mehretu, who, through her works addresses political, social and cultural themes, Victor Man - who approaches themes from his own biography and Alina Gherasim who express her experiences through collages and paintings. I need to translate the mental images, related to contemporary events and my feelings within, into forms that can transmit my intentions to others; my works are my experiments and represent the desire to convey messages to the world!
